Deruta Raffaellesco 7″ Large Cachepot Planter
This Italian ceramic flower pot was handcrafted and painted by the artisans in Deruta, Italy by Ceramiche Sberna. Raffaellesco is a classic Umbrian maiolica pattern that has its origins in Deruta during the Renaissance when pottery artisans were inspired by the frescoes of Raphael. The image shows the planter from the front. This planter does not have a hole for drainage as it can be used as a cachepot. If you would like to use it as a planter, please use the comment section in your order to indicate you would like us to drill a hole.
This plant pot is seven inches in height and eight inches in diameter at the rim. Measurements are approximate.
